powered by simpleCommunicator - 2.0.53     © 2025 Programmizd 02
Форумы / Oracle APEX [игнор отключен] [закрыт для гостей] / перенести бд и приложение
8 сообщений из 8, страница 1 из 1
перенести бд и приложение
    #36665424
klimovo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ый вечер!
Необходимо базу данных и приложение, которое ее использует, скопировать для переноса и дальнейшей установки на другом компе. Как это реализовать? И напишите, пожалуйста, это займет длительное время? Спасибо большое!
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36665482
tyshenko
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Версия базы?
Платформа с которой и на которую переносите?
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36665497
klimovo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
используется Oracle 10g XE, pc - pc, возможно pc - mac.
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36666058
tyshenko
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
На pc установить в тотже каталог.
Остановить сервисы на источнике и привемние.
Скопировать каталог.
Запустить.
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36666063
klimovo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
вопрос не в этом. какие файлы надо копировать чтобы перенести всю бд и приложение
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36666916
tyshenko
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
все что есть в каталоге в файлами *.dbf
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36670443
Фотография yurey
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
tyshenko,
Попробуц с помощью exp, imp попробуй в cmd. Получается. А приложение аналогично через среду APEX.
...
Рейтинг: 0 / 0
перенести бд и приложение
    #36673819
Ngels
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
По-поводу копирования папок - первый раз слышу...

Я делаю двумя способами (из под Windows XP):

1) С помощью утилит expdp и impdp

*ВНИМАНИЕ! В новой БД необходимо создать новую схему с таким же именем, какая в той БД, что переносим. Назовем её "СХЕМА".
Текже, в новой БД нужно переименовать tablespace, чтобы был как в старой БД.


*ЭКСПОРТ:

*Создаем каталог, где будет лежать дампфайл через cmd (или просто через проводник):

*Из под CMD (меню -> пуск -> выполнить -> cmd):
Код: plaintext
MKDIR c:\DUMPFOLDER

*Из под CMD:
Код: plaintext
1.
2.
3.
4.
5.
SET NLS_LANG=RUSSIAN_RUSSIA.RU8PC866
sqlplus
connect system/"ПАРОЛЬ"
CREATE OR REPLACE DIRECTORY dmpdir AS 'C:\DUMPFOLDER';
GRANT READ,WRITE ON DIRECTORY dmpdir TO "СХЕМА";
*Из под CMD:
expdp SYSTEM/"ПАРОЛЬ" SCHEMAS="СХЕМА" DIRECTORY=DATAPUMP DUMPFILE="СХЕМА".dmp LOGFILE=expschema"СХЕМА".log

Все, теперь файл с данными лежит в папке C:\DUMPFOLDER, его нужно скопировать в такую же папку на новом компьютере.


*ИМПОРТ:

*Из под CMD:
Код: plaintext
1.
2.
3.
4.
5.
6.
SET NLS_LANG=RUSSIAN_RUSSIA.RU8PC866
sqlplus
connect system/"ПАРОЛЬ"
CREATE OR REPLACE DIRECTORY dmpdir AS 'C:\DUMPFOLDER';
GRANT READ,WRITE ON DIRECTORY dmpdir TO "СХЕМА";
impdp SYSTEM/"ПАРОЛЬ" SCHEMAS="СХЕМА" DIRECTORY=dmpdir DUMPFILE="СХЕМА".dmp REMAP_SCHEMA="СХЕМА":"СХЕМА" TABLE_EXISTS_ACTION=replace LOGFILE=impschema.log

2) С помощью Oracle SQL Developer

Подключившись как пользователь, в меню tools -> database export.

Потом на новой машине запускаем через тотже SQL Developer этот скрипт.


ЭТО ВСЕ КАСАЛОСЬ ДАННЫХ И СТРУКТУРЫ, САМО ПРИЛОЖЕНИЕ ЭКСПОРТИРУЕТСЯ ЧЕРЕЗ МЕНЮ APEX.


Вроде как в SQL Developer можно и приложение экспортнуть, но я пока не пробовал.
...
Рейтинг: 0 / 0
8 сообщений из 8, страница 1 из 1
Форумы / Oracle APEX [игнор отключен] [закрыт для гостей] / перенести бд и приложение
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]